The Role
The Manager – Business Planning will support the Head of Business Planning in driving end-to-end business planning, demand forecasting, and performance management activities across domestic and export markets.
This role will play a critical part in translating strategic objectives into executable business plans by coordinating cross-functional inputs, monitoring performance, and ensuring alignment between demand, supply, and commercial priorities. The position requires a highly analytical and commercially minded individual who thrives in fast-paced, ambiguity-heavy environments and can effectively partner across Sales, Marketing, Product Planning, Finance, Supply Chain, and Operations.
Duties/Responsibilities
Annual Operating Plan (AOP) Support
Support the Annual Operating Plan (AOP) process across domestic and export markets
Assist in defining volume, revenue, and market share assumptions across models, regions, and channels
Consolidate planning inputs from Sales, Marketing, Product Planning, and Finance teams
Support alignment between strategic assumptions and operational execution plans
Demand Planning
Partner closely with the Sales Planning team to develop and maintain demand forecasts
Break down targets by region, country, dealer, and model level
Monitor forecast accuracy and identify variances between plan, forecast, and actual performance
Support the continuous improvement of planning methodologies and forecasting assumptions
Policy Planning & MPCP Deployment
Support deployment and execution of policy planning frameworks and MPCP initiatives
Assist in maintaining structured governance, planning cadences, and tracking mechanisms
Collaborate with TQM and Business Planning teams to ensure process discipline and compliance
Market Performance Tracking
Monitor retail performance, wholesale trends, and market share movements
Conduct competitor benchmarking and market performance analysis
Support the preparation of monthly and quarterly business performance reviews
Supply & Demand Coordination
Coordinate with Supply Chain and Operations teams to align demand forecasts with supply availability
Highlight risks and gaps between demand plans and operational constraints
Support launch readiness planning and volume tracking activities
Support closed-loop aftersales quality tracking and Product Quality Management (PQM) activities
Cross-Functional Coordination
Act as a key coordination point between Sales, Marketing, Product, Finance, and Operations teams
Ensure timely collection, validation, and consolidation of planning inputs
Support the execution of business planning reviews and operating rhythms
MIS, Reporting & Analytics
Develop and maintain weekly and monthly management dashboards and reporting tools
Conduct variance analysis across Plan vs Actual vs Forecast performance
Prepare data-driven reports and presentations for leadership reviews
Ensure accuracy, consistency, and timeliness of reporting outputs
Issue Tracking & Risk Management
Identify deviations, execution risks, and gaps in planning assumptions
Proactively escalate key risks and issues to the Head of Business Planning
Support structured tracking and resolution of critical business planning actions
Personal Specification
7–10 years of experience across Business Planning, Sales, Marketing, or Strategic Planning functions
Experience within both established multinational organisations and high-growth environments preferred
Exposure to UK and USA markets is desirable
Strong experience in demand planning, volume forecasting, sales strategy, and cross-functional execution
Experience operating within matrix organisations and regional/global reporting structures
